QUESTION NO.9
QUESTION: Councillor C. O'Connor
To ask the Chief Executive to report to the Council on any contacts he has had with the Department of Environment and Local Government regarding the recent announcement by Government that funding is to be made available for social housing and will he also confirm if he is working on plans to respond to such funding?
REPLY:
SDCC is currently awaiting details and guidance from DECLG on the budget announcements and the proposed housing strategy which is expected to be launched over the next couple of weeks.
The Council currently has 260 Units over a number of proposed developments with the Department of the Environment Community and Local Government for approval. These proposals have been through the Part 8 process and approved by the Council. the Council is currently in the process of identifying other suitable infill sites. It is hoped to increase the number of new units of social housing with the Department up to approximately 500 for approval within the first quarter of 2015.
